10th FILMPOLSKA FESTIVAL IN BERLIN

The tenth edition of the filmPOLSKA festival will run in Berlin from April 22 through April 29, 2015.

New Polish Cinema

The festival lineup features a number of recent Polish films, including BODY/CIAŁO by Małgorzata Szumowska, recently awarded at Berlinale, as well as Hardkor Disko (Hardcore Disco) by Krzysztof Skonieczny, Małe stłuczki (Little Crushes) by Aleksandra Gowin and Ireneusz Grzyb, Wałęsa. Człowiek z nadziei (Wałęsa. Man of Hope) by Andrzej Wajda, Miasto 44 (Warsaw 44) by Jan Komasa, and Powstanie warszawskie (The Warsaw Uprising), the world’s first feature film consisting entirely of documentary footage.

Agnieszka Holland Retrospective

Festival audiences will have an opportunity to see a retrospective of films by director Agnieszka Holland. The festival will screen Olivier, Olivier, The Secret Garden, Total Eclipse, Kobieta samotna (A Woman Alone), W ciemności (In Darkness), and Burning Bush. The lineup also features Powroty Agnieszki H. (The Returns of Agnieszka H.), a documentary film about Holland, directed by Jacek Petrycki and Krystyna Krauze.

Cinema Education

The festival lineup also features a section called ‘Kinoedukacja,’ which will showcase a number of Polish productions, including Made in Poland by Przemysław Wojcieszek, Dzień świra (The Day of the Wacko) by Marek Koterski, and Zawrócony (The Convert) by Kazimierz Kutz.
